made by Yoav Kagan for Ludum Dare 58 (JAM)

A meditative stone-stacking game where you gather rocks and carefully balance them to create tranquil towers. Collect, place, and adjust each stone to reach harmony before the pile collapses.
As your tower grows taller, you unlock new inventory slots, allowing you to collect and experiment with even more stones, and maybe stumble upon a few hidden secrets waiting to be uncovered...

Find all 6 secrets to finish the game!

Controls

Stack:
- Mouse to stack rocks
- Use the arrow keys, A–D, or scroll wheel to rotate rocks

Collect:
- Click on rocks to collect them
- Move around with the arrow keys, A–D, or by dragging the mouse
